Change in Use of First-class Postage From Requirement to Recommendation
folder_openChanges to Protocols and Guidelinescalendar_todayPosted September 1, 2010

The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) and the Home Health Care CAHPS (HHCAHPS) Survey Coordination Team are changing the requirement that vendors mail HHCAHPS Survey questionnaires using first-class postage or indicia to be a recommendation. Vendors should discuss with their client home health agencies the advantages and disadvantages of using first-class postage versus bulk rate mailing and make an appropriate decision about the postage to use for their particular survey. This change is effective immediately and will be reflected in the next version of the HHCAHPS Protocols and Guidelines Manual, which will be posted on the HHCAHPS Web site in early September.
